Transaction 184000062c7a94c561de8b26c1f05add4b5615ce819ab84975a2316785659053
1 Input
1 Output
-
184000062c7a94c561de8b26c1f05add4b5615ce819ab84975a2316785659053:0
- value
- 68568
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ad802aa0ab8a62765438b51ee31df3a20c89e8b9fb8c792ae207bf99103381bb
- address
- bc1p4kqz4g9t3f38v4pck50wx80n5gxgn69elwx8j2hzq7lejypnsxasfmmu7w